Responsibilities

  • Collect, analyse and present information for planning meetings, work plans and budgets
  • Create and maintain projects in Quantum, including budget revisions and project status updates
  • Provide administrative, operational and logistical support for project outputs and events
  • Coordinate procurement processes for goods, services and individual contracts
  • Process and monitor payments and track project expenditures against budgets
  • Compile information for bi-annual, financial, substantive and final reports
  • Maintain electronic and hard-copy filing systems for audit and record management
